When visiting a new country, you’ll often hear about local SIMs as a cost-effective solution. But what exactly is a local SIM, and how does it function? A local SIM is issued by a telecom provider within the destination country. It operates exclusively within that country’s borders, directly connecting to domestic networks and offering plans designed for local users. SIMply purchase a local SIM upon arrival, insert it into your phone, activate it, and you’re ready to access calls, SMS, and mobile data.

1. Advantages of using a SIM local 

  • Lower costs at your destination: A local SIM is typically more affordable than a travel SIM, especially for data usage within that country.

  • More stable network connection: Since it connects directly to local networks, you can expect reliable service with fewer disruptions.

  • Flexible plans available: Local SIMs usually offer various options—daily, weekly, and monthly plans suited to individual needs.

2. Disadvantages of using a SIM local 

  • Limited coverage area: A local SIM only works within one country. If you travel to another country, it will no longer be functional.

  • More complicated registration: Some countries require identification such as a passport for SIM registration, which can be time-consuming.

  • Language barriers: Communicating with local shop staff may be challenging if you’re unfamiliar with the local language.

As cross-border travel becomes more common, travel SIMs have gained popularity among international tourists. A travel SIM is provided by international telecom providers and works across multiple countries without needing to switch SIM cards. In addition to physical SIMs, many travel SIMs are now available as eSIMs, which you can activate online via a QR code without handling physical SIM cards.

1. Advantages of using a travel SIM

  • Purchase before your trip: Travel SIMs can be bought in your home country before departure.

  • Multi-country usage: Perfect for travelers visiting multiple countries on the same trip.

  • Quick and convenient: No need to search for a local shop at your destination—you’re connected as soon as you land.

2. Disadvantages of using a travel SIM

  • Higher costs: Travel SIMs are generally more expensive due to multi-country roaming features.

  • Data limitations: Some travel SIMs may restrict your data or reduce speeds after exceeding a certain limit.

Local SIM vs travel SIM: A detailed comparison

Local SIM vs travel SIM, which one should you choose? If you are still unsure which option to choose, this comparison table will give you a clear overview:

Criteria Local SIM Travel SIM
Cost Generally cheaper within the local area More expensive but offers extra convenience
Coverage Works in one country only Works across multiple countries
Purchase & Activation In-person purchase, may require documentation Online purchase, quick activation via QR code
Customer Support Local support, may face language barriers 24/7 multilingual international support
Connection Stability Highly stable within the destination country Stable but may come with data restrictions

When should you choose a local SIM?

While both SIM options serve travelers, a local SIM is particularly advantageous in certain travel situations. Below are the most common scenarios where opting for a local SIM proves to be the most cost-effective and practical choice.

  • Long-term stay in one country: If you are visiting a single country for weeks or months (e.g., work trips, student exchange, or remote work), a local SIM helps you save on data and call charges compared to international SIMs. Local providers offer better rates and larger data packages.

  • High data consumption: For remote workers or heavy users (video calls, streaming, file uploads), local SIMs often provide more affordable high-data or unlimited plans, plus faster local network speeds.

  • Comfortable with local procedures: If you are fine with registering a SIM (showing your passport or filling out forms) and dealing with local shops, a local SIM will give you more flexibility and lower costs.

When should you choose a travel SIM?

Travel SIMs are best suited for specific traveler profiles, especially those with dynamic itineraries or shorter stays. Here’s when choosing a travel SIM becomes the more convenient and efficient option.

  • Multi-country travel: If you plan to visit several countries on one trip (e.g., Thailand – Singapore – Malaysia), a travel SIM ensures smooth roaming without swapping SIMs at each border.

  • Convenience first: Want internet as soon as you land? Travel SIMs or eSIMs can be activated before your flight, giving you instant connectivity upon arrival.

  • Short-term trips: For quick holidays or business trips (a few days to a week), a travel SIM saves time and avoids the hassle of hunting for a local provider.

Local SIM Cards - Buy after you arrive:

Local SIM cards are widely available at international airports, shopping malls, convenience stores (e.g., 7-Eleven, FamilyMart), and official mobile carrier stores (e.g., AIS in Thailand, SoftBank in Japan).

  • At the airport: This is the most convenient option, but prices may be slightly higher. You’ll usually find SIM booths near the arrival gates.

  • In the city: Local shops and telecom stores in downtown areas often offer more competitive rates and a wider range of plans.

Note: In many countries, buying a local SIM may require passport registration, and staff may not always speak English. Be prepared to fill out forms or follow local verification processes.
